Eclipse集成开发环境:重塑软件开发新纪元的创新平台
- 问答
- 2025-09-22 03:57:26
- 2
Eclipse:那个让我又爱又恨的代码老伙计
第一次打开Eclipse的时候,我差点被它那灰扑扑的界面劝退——这玩意儿真的能写代码?但十年后的今天,我不得不承认,它就像那个脾气古怪但极其靠谱的老同事,虽然偶尔卡得让人想砸键盘,但关键时刻总能救你一命。
为什么Eclipse还没被时代淘汰?
在VS Code和IntelliJ IDEA大行其道的今天,Eclipse的存在感似乎越来越低,但奇怪的是,每次我接手一个老项目,或者需要调试某个上古Java代码时,第一个想到的还是它,为什么?
- 插件生态的“野蛮生长”:Eclipse的插件市场像个杂货铺,什么都有,但质量参差不齐,我曾经为了装一个Python插件,折腾了整整一下午,最后发现它和我的JDK版本不兼容……但一旦配好,它就能变成你的专属开发环境,比那些“开箱即用”的现代IDE更灵活。
- 对老项目的兼容性:有些企业级Java项目,用的还是Ant构建,Maven都没上,你拿VS Code打开?祝你好运,Eclipse虽然慢,但对这些“古董”代码的解析能力依然强悍。
- 调试器的“玄学稳定”:它的调试器有时候会莫名其妙卡住,但一旦跑起来,断点、变量监视、表达式计算……样样不差,我曾经靠它硬生生挖出一个内存泄漏问题,而其他IDE在那会儿直接崩了。
那些让人抓狂的瞬间
Eclipse也不是什么完美工具,它的槽点能写满三页A4纸:
- 启动速度堪比老牛拉车:尤其是装了五六个插件后,启动时间足够我泡杯咖啡再回来,有次我急着改个bug,结果等了整整两分钟,最后发现是我忘记关掉“自动更新索引”……
- 内存占用是个谜:有时候它安静如鸡,只占几百MB;有时候突然狂吃4GB内存,风扇转得像要起飞,我一度怀疑它是不是在后台偷偷挖矿。
- UI设计停留在XP时代:那个灰蓝色的主题,配上锯齿感十足的字体,总让我有种穿越回2005年的错觉,虽然可以换皮肤,但再怎么折腾,也掩盖不了它的“复古”气质。
它教会我的事:工具不是信仰
用了这么多年Eclipse,我最大的感悟是:没有完美的工具,只有合适的场景。
- 写新项目?我可能会选IntelliJ IDEA,因为它更智能。
- 快速修个小bug?VS Code轻便又顺手。
- 但如果是维护一个老旧的、依赖复杂的企业级Java系统?对不起,还是得请Eclipse出马。
它就像一把瑞士军刀,不是最锋利的,也不是最好看的,但当你需要它的时候,它总能从兜里掏出来,帮你解决那些奇奇怪怪的问题。
Eclipse的未来?
有人说Eclipse已经“过气”了,但我觉得,只要还有人在维护那些老代码,它就死不了,它可能不会成为“新纪元的创新平台”,但它绝对是软件开发史上一个无法绕过的里程碑——就像那个陪伴你多年的旧键盘,手感一般,但你就是舍不得换。
(PS:写完这篇文章,我的Eclipse又卡死了……果然,爱恨交织啊。)
本文由宜白风于2025-09-22发表在笙亿网络策划,如有疑问,请联系我们。
本文链接:http://pro.xlisi.cn/wenda/34369.html